Justin Nsengiyumva Sworn in as Prime Minister, Vows to Prioritize Citizen Welfare

Justin Nsengiyumva was officially sworn in as Rwanda’s new Prime Minister on Friday, July 25, just two days after President Paul Kagame appointed him to the role, replacing Edouard Ngirente, who had held the position since 2017. In the ceremony presided over by President Kagame, Nsengiyumva pledged loyalty to the Republic of Rwanda and commitment to upholding the Constitution and laws of the country.
